How to Turn Your Garage Into a Bedroom

If you are thinking that your garage could be more useful as a bedroom instead of as the parking spot for the car, then we have put together a list of steps to help. If you want to convert the garage into a living space, here is how to do it:

First things first, we have to remind people that it is possible that you might need a building permit in order to do this kind of construction. Make sure to check out your local permit requirements and obtain the permission you need before starting, so that you don’t end up doing any illegal projects.

Once you set a budget for yourself and figure out an exact plan for what the room will include (bathroom, extra windows, lighting and heating), the first step is to insulate the garage so that it can remain at a livable temperature. The ceiling and all four walls need to be insulated properly and of course, the floor. Since garages usually have cold concrete grounds, you’ll have to factor in a way to insulate that as well, whether it is through carpeting or raising the floor height.

After you insulate, you’ll need to add the drywall and then you can start to paint. And once you have the walls finished, start to think about the electrical wiring and how much more power the new room might need. We recommend hiring an electrician to take care of installing outlets and light switches and such. And while you’re at it, don’t forget about the need for heating and cooling and decide whether you want to tie a heater into the house’s main system or add a new independent system.

After you’ve taken care of the essentials like electricity, insulation, and temperature control, you can start to decorate. When it comes to adding furniture and a bed, keep the windows and natural light in mind as well as adding the bed to the wall with the best insulation. If you want the new bedroom to flow into the rest of the house, make sure to decorate it similar to other rooms, with common themes and colors.

Depending on how much time, effort, and money you want to put into the project, you can either have this professionally done or make it your next DIY job.
